I would like to ask a question about accessing VIEWS through Web Service.
I have created a view in Host Monitor. In Properties->Columns section, I selected "Use view's own column settings" and modified the visible columns as my need. The modified column settings are valid in Host Monitor->Views. However, the same column settings are not seen when I look this view at Web Service. My question: is this expected? I mean, are the modified column settings for a view not applied in Web Service?

Web Service has its own settings and user profiles.
You may click "Preferences" link to changed user settings.
